Content
Look for simple, fast, and manageable communication, an absence of language barriers, and the ability to avoid time zone issues. Choose convenient communication channels and planners — a project manager can help with it. Try not to hire developers if you’re waiting for their response for ages. Consider several options of finding and hiring specialists so that you have more choice and freedom.
They ensure the behind-the-scenes elements, like application logic and architecture, are top-notch so that your solution performs in the best possible manner. After you’ve created your account, you will start the quiz right away. Make sure to dedicate the necessary time to assessing your technical skills. We’re very happy with the service provided by the QA engineers from Pentalog. Thanks to Pentalog, we have achieved a 70% of automated testing coverage for our APIs.
Android specialist teams for any requirement
Each team member is partially experienced in many product development fields, but none has deep expertise in a specific branch. Practice shows that the team structure plays a crucial role in the success of the final product. The proper teamwork gives the right direction to product development. So if you want your product to reach the stratosphere, gather your development team, like NASA selects the astronauts.
They will know what the users need in such on-demand applications, which helps the business analyst establish the app requirements. Here’s a complete blog of how to hire app developers that perfectly fit your requirements. This is when the quality assurance team will be working full-fledged. They will be joined by the other teams like UI/UX and development to make the necessary iterations to the mobile app solution.
These different connections will help you out in order to get to know an individual on professional. The most important trust is built on reliable grounds apart from work experience. Upon the development of first software version, it should be tested to verify how it works, whether everything is functioning properly or not.
Sales & Marketing Specialists
Get your mobile app development budget straight with our ultimate guide to the app development cost. Now that you know what roles constitute an effective mobile app development team, it’s time to talk about actually finding one. All in all, BAs are essential members of the mobile app development team.
A business analyst will be responsible for developing new models, and work closely with IT teams, designers, and finance teams whenever required. Being in the position of a business analyst should have a combination of hard skills and soft skills. It is important to understand why you need a solid development team structure before you know the roles they will play in developing your iOS or Android app. Outsourcing means you can take the whole app development process off your hands. Your outsourcing provider leads all the development processes from start to finish. Staff augmentation is a way to power up your existing app development team by adding needed specialists.
App Development Stages and the Application Development Team Roles
Every development team, whether it’s creating a mobile app or anything else, needs a project manager. The design and development stage means that your team will start building a minimal viable product to field test your business idea. An MVP is a version of the app that is feature-oriented and includes just the basic functionality that solves the primary pain points of the target audience. While validating your app idea, you will need a project/product manager, a designer, iOS and Android developers, a backend developer, and a QA engineer. At this stage, you need to envision your app, its features, and its business logic. While validating your business idea, you need to state the app’s goals, value, and features and research your competitors.
To hire credible talent for your team, it’s worth asking around your professional network. However, the process might be slow if you’re new to the industry and don’t know many people. Based on beta tester comments, you may begin to create a medium-fidelity app prototype that depicts your app’s UX design and flow.
Designers
A project manager is a key figure responsible for managing the app development process. We have realized the importance of a mobile app development team structure. Check out the people and their roles as part of mobile app development.
That is the reason every division ought to have a group head that is answerable for all undertakings his/her specialists execute. Furthermore, qualified group pioneers should screen the work process in their specialization. It will guarantee that the procedure will go intelligently and any difficulties won’t emerge. This way, you can mitigate resource limitation issues and ensure your project meets deadlines.
Developers are the folks who turn all of the UI/UX designs into functioning applications. As a result, they should have prior experience working with your preferred os and its respective languages or with cross-platform tools. A Business stages of team development team building analyst, as the name implies, does a business analysis at the start of a project. They will examine the business needs and assist in setting the appropriate goals so that the development method is appropriate for your specific instance.
- Designers of user interactions are mostly focused on the user’s navigation of a digital product.
- Furthermore, each member is responsible for their part in the development process, and software development teams generally take such an approach.
- The first case is quite typical and does not require specialists on the team .
- A QA engineer can perform different types of testing, such as quality assurance, performance testing, integration testing, regression testing, etc.
- This is true whether you’re outsourcing or creating your app in-house.
They offer adequate technical and maintenance assistance during and after the implementation of your mobile application. Becoming a member of Meetup.com, Toptal.com, and Dribbble.com which are local industry groups. It will help you out in your quest of creating the application development team structure that is geographically collocated. As these are the places where you can find day-to-day events and meet up people with same interests of design, development, and strategies.
Stage 4: App Development
At any stage of development, it’s possible to see and use exactly what has been created, not just read reports or look at screenshots. AppReal usesAgile, which was derived from Scrum and has quickly become one of the most popular software development methodology in the world. Modern app development is much more complex than the “guy in a garage” of the past. Depending on the scale of an app, dozens of people could be needed to bring it to life. If you’re exploring your options to have a mobile app created, then you should first understand exactly what you’re paying for. When looking at app complexity, mobile apps will fall into three categories – simple, medium, and complex.
How Much Does it Cost to Hire a Mobile App Development Team?
Typically, coders use React Native to speed up and simplify the whole app development process. Apps built on React Native share a codebase between the iOS and Android versions, with 65-70% of the same code — and that’s not the only advantage. They also have a deep understanding of UI/UX design and adaptive layout.
For example, when selecting designers, you should have key requirements in mind. You can call for people with time management and problem-solving abilities. For example, if the designer will take 10 days to complete the screens, at the end of the time period, they should connect with the developer for a job transfer.
Depending on your choice, you need to choose the developers for the team. Contact us to discuss the team structure you need to turn your idea into a full-scale mobile app. It’s never solely the app’s idea that determines if the app will be successful. Various factors affect an app’s outcome, including its features, design, performance, and many others. However, the app’s development team is one of the most influential factors in an app’s success. Take advantage of the diverse and deep knowledge of our mobile development team.
Sales and Marketing department:
The main task of a QA is to spot any bugs before release of the app or new features. As a company specializing in mobile app development, we often get questions about the mobile development team structure, the experts who should be on the team, and how to make the right choice. After all, choosing a team incapable of delivering the solutions may result in a high financial loss.
Since the dedicated mobile app development team is hired remotely, it helps you save all these costs without having to concede on the work quality. When you employ a dedicated mobile app team, you get access to multiple experienced professionals who are committed to fulfilling your business objectives. This app development team seems and acts like an in-house team, which is technically on your payroll.